Marija Miloshevska
******************@*****.***
Technical summary
Consultant with 7+ years' experience, with great ability to work under
time-pressure and in stressful conditions, prompt, reliable,
responsible, highly motivated. Excellent troubleshooting and
analytical skills. Excellent communication skills. I have led or
participated on teams doing analysis, design, development,
implementations, enhancements, testing of applications. Ability to
work both as a team-member and individually.
Skills
. Solid background in Object-Oriented analysis and design;
. Design/development and support of Java/J2EE based systems;
. Open source frameworks like Struts, Spring to implement enterprise
applications;
. Hibernate, JPA, JDBC, Spring Data
. Weblogic portal platform 8.1 and 10.3.2 (Books, and Pages, Nested Page
flows)
. Databases: MSSQL 2005/2008/2012
. JavaScript, JSP, Ajax, HTML, CSS
. Servers: WebLogic, Apache tomcat, JBoss, WebSphere Application server
8.5
. Version control: CVS, SVN
. XML, XSLT, XPath
. IBM BPM 8.5.5
. Maven
. Junit, Spring TestContext Framework
. Tracking tools JIRA and HP Quality Center
. .NET: C#, LINQ, WCF
. Knowledge of JAXB, SSIS 2005/2008, ADAM, Spring MVC, Jenkins, Multi-
threading, Jmeter
Professional experience
Perficient, Consultant (10/2012- Present)
Customer: Frontier Communications
Role: Technical Consultant
Duration: 4 months
Frontier's strategy for managing interactions with customers, clients
and sales prospects needed to be expanded to the commercial side of
the organization. The existing system was in WPS 6 and DXSI. Migrating
to IBM BPM suite to serve Frontier Communications as a professional
services and IT solutions provider. This technology will organize,
automate and synchronize business processes, sales and service
activities.
Solution utilized: IBM BPM 8.5 Suite, IBM Telecom Pack 8.5, Java,
Oracle 11g, DXSI, CVS.
Responsibilities:
. Analyzing existing mapping in DXSI and converted them into BPM
mappings.
. Analyzing existing mapping in WPS 6 and converted them into BPM
mappings.
. Developing BPEL processes
. Unit testing - SOAPUI
. Deploying on Dev servers
. Attending Daily Scrum and Weekly project status meetings and
providing status report.
Customer: Matrix Medical Network
Role: Technical Consultant
Duration: 1 year
Member State Model & Eligibility is a system support for many
different states of the member, beyond just eligibility status,
depending upon the current activity and data relevant to the member
for all product lines.
System also provides a centralized system for managing the state of a
member for other partner applications.
Solution utilized: Java, JAXB, JBoss 7.1, MSSQL 2008, JPA, Spring
Framework, Spring Data, SSIS, Maven.
Responsibilities:
. Developing CRUD services
. Developing parts from the process flow
. Creating JUnit tests using Spring TestContext Framework
. Regression testing
. Writing population sql scripts
. Creating SSIS package
. Attending Daily Scrum and Weekly project status meetings and
providing status report.
Customer: FirstGroup America, Inc
Role: Technical Consultant
Duration: 5 months
Greyhound.com Changes
Greyhound wanted to enhance the features available to customers on the
two primary landing pages (Greyhound and Greyhound Express). In order
to improve the initial experience of the customer. Greyhound liked to
improve their ability to keep these pages fresh by providing a simple
content management feature to facilitate the updating of banners and
badges displayed on the landing pages.
Greyhound Consumer Mobile Applications
Greyhound wanted design and development of a mobile application
targeting Greyhound consumers. This application would be developed
for the iOS and Android platforms. Creating RESTful services with
Windows Communication Foundation (WCF) calling existing service layer
Both projects utilized a sprint-based agile methodology.
Solution utilized: C#, .NET, WCF
Responsibilities:
. Developing Greyhound.com CR
. QA testing on Greyhound.com changes
. Developing RESTful services with Windows Communication Foundation
(WCF)
Interworks( Perficient Offshore Company), Sr. Software Developer
(05/2006 - 10/2012)
Customer: Agency for encouraging agriculture development
Role: Sr. Software Developer, Business Analyst, Database Developer
Duration: 1 year
SEMPA (System for evaluation, monitoring and planning activities) is
custom software solution for improving and supporting workflow of the
Agency for Development of the Agriculture of Republic of Macedonia.
The challenge was an iterative implementation of diverse set of
requirements that keep coming with growth of software solution.
Solution utilized: ASP.NET, C#, LINQ, AJAX.NET, Microsoft Visual
Studio.NET 2010, NUnit, Linq2SQL Profiler, SQL Server 2005
Responsibilities:
. Gathering business requirements from meeting session with the client
. Database design
. GUI design
. Regression testing
. Developing back end services
. Defect tracking
Customer: Cricket Communications
Role: Data Analyst
Duration: 3 months
Data Documentation Project is for a reverse engineering of the ETL
jobs within an Oracle database using SAP BusinessObjects Data Service
Designer tool and SQL Developer to document how different data feeds
flow through the system. That is done by following each data feed
through the system
Responsibilities:
. Documenting different data feeds flows
Customer: Broadlane (MedAssest) - Development, Support & Maintenance
Role: Developer (Development phase), Lead Developer (Support &
Maintenance phase)
Duration: 4 years
This application focuses on the contractors services for various
medical facilities (including hospitals, urgent care, clinics, etc.)
across the United States. This service offering objective is to act as
a bridge between the facilities that require contract nursing staff
and the Agencies that supply staff based on demand. As a result, the
facilities can request staff when required at predefined rates and
service levels. On the other hand, Agencies have assured business from
the facilities. Application provides following functionalities: Job
requisition creation; Candidate evaluation and hiring; License and
certification evaluation; Vendor performance assessment; Reverse
invoicing; Financial metrics and compliance reporting.
Solution utilized: J2EE, Struts, Hibernate, Ajax, JSP, Javascript, Bea
Weblogic Platform 8.1, Weblogic 10.3.2, SSIS, MSSQL 2005
Responsibilities:
. Participated in development of enterprise application.
. Application Configuration and Deployment;
. Managing server domain and clustering, portal administration and
visitor entitlements, updating build scripts
. Implementing methods for frontend, business tier, back-end tier
Hibernate;
. Estimating and assigning tasks
. Resolving/tracking(HP Quality center) defects and change
requests;
. Used J2EE and JSP to implement page flows for a BEA WebLogic
portal;
. Code Review;
. Creating and updating stored procedures and triggers regarding
improving performance;
. Organizing and performing regression testing on all modules from the
application for each release;
. Defect tracking
Customer: Download Manager
Role: Developer
Duration: 3 months
Participated in team doing software development. This product is WEB
based application for downloading different products by an end-client
from a web interface. The application allows setting up different
download sources and configuring download permissions and product
licenses per product/user. The application utilizes Struts and J2EE
technologies. The application can be used with Oracle or MsSQL
databases, and can run on any Java compatible web server.
Solution utilized: Java, Struts, J2EE, MSSQL, JBoss, Java Scripts
Responsibilities:
. Developing and testing workflows
Education
. Bachelor of Computer Science, University of St. Kliment Ohridski -
Bitola, Macedonia